#158f8d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#158f8d is composed of 8.2% red, 56.1% green and 55.3%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 85.3% cyan, 0% magenta, 1.4% yellow and 43.9% black. It has a hue angle of 179 degrees, a saturation of 74.4% and a lightness of 32.2%. #158f8d color hex could be obtained by blending #2affff with #001f1b. Closest websafe color is: #009999.

Shades and Tints of #158f8d
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#010606 is the darkest color, while #f4fdfd is the lightest one.

Tones of #158f8d
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#4e5656 is the less saturated color, while #02a29f is the most saturated one.
